java个人所得税计算方法计算方法 : 全月应纳税所得额 =工资薪金所得-3500 应纳税额 = 应纳税所得额 *税率-速算扣除数

个人所得税计算方法计算方法 :
全月应纳税所得额 =工资薪金所得-3500
应纳税额 = 应纳税所得额 *税率-速算扣除数
(自己初学Java做的小练习)
在这里插入图片描述

import java.util.Scanner;
public class TestDemo{
    
    
	public static void main(String[] args){
    
    
		Scanner sc=new Scanner(System.in);             //与键盘建立连接
		System.out.println("请输入你的薪水:");
		double salary=sc.nextDouble();
		double taxableIncome = salary -3500;
		if(taxableIncome>100000){
    
    
			double sum=salary-(taxableIncome*0.45-15375);
			System.out.println("实际工资"+sum);			
		}else if(taxableIncome>80000){
    
    
			double sum=salary-(taxableIncome*0.4-10375);
			System.out.println("实际工资"+sum);			
		}else if(taxableIncome>60000){
    
    
			double sum=salary-(taxableIncome*0.35-6375);
			System.out.println("实际工资"+sum);			
		}else if(taxableIncome>40000){
    
    
			double sum=salary-(taxableIncome*0.3-3375);
			System.out.println("实际工资"+sum);			
		}else if(taxableIncome>20000){
    
    
			double sum=salary-(taxableIncome*0.25-1375);
			System.out.println("实际工资"+sum);			
		}else if(taxableIncome>5000){
    
    
			double sum=salary-(taxableIncome*0.2-375);
			System.out.println("实际工资"+sum);			
		}else if(taxableIncome>2000){
    
    
			double sum=salary-(taxableIncome*0.15-125);
			System.out.println("实际工资"+sum);			
		}else if(taxableIncome>500){
    
    
			double sum=salary-(taxableIncome*0.10-25);
			System.out.println("实际工资"+sum);			
		}else if(taxableIncome>0){
    
    
			double sum=salary-(taxableIncome*0.05-0);
			System.out.println("实际工资"+sum);			
		}else{
    
    
			System.out.println("你还没有交税的资格");
		}
		
	}
}


运行结果如下:
在这里插入图片描述

猜你喜欢

转载自blog.csdn.net/weixin_43462140/article/details/114106045